Choosing the Right Diamond Shape For the Engagement Ring
Engagement rings are no doubt one of the most important pieces of jewelry a woman adorns in her life.
It is very important that everything is just right with the chosen rings.
One of the most important things to be chosen is the right diamond shape for the engagement rings.
All you have to do is understand the difference between the various classic diamond.
Once you do this it becomes really easy for you to choose the best diamond shape for the rings.
Here are some tips to choose the right diamond for the engagement rings: • The best and the most suitable thing is to involve then ask the bride-to-be to choose the right diamond.
It is the easiest way of discovering the perfect diamond that suits the preferences of the bride's requirements.
• A perfect way is to check the shapes of diamonds in the other jewelry owned by the bride.
For an instance, if the bride has a favorite pendant with a princess cut diamond then it is better to buy an engagement ring with a princess cut diamond.
• Deciding the budget beforehand can help you to find the right shape that easily fits inside.
This is because the different diamond shapes come with different price tags.
Generally, the least expensive shape is classic round diamonds.
The various specialty shapes like the Leo diamond, the Asscher shapes and the Heart shapes have a higher price tag.
This is because these shapes have a number of facets and feature cuts that are much more intricate.
• You should examine the shape of the hands and fingers to decide on the diamond shapes.
Usually, the round shaped diamonds are suitable for almost all type of fingers.
If your bride-to-be has tapered and thin fingers, she can wear elongated diamond shapes like oval, marquise and emerald shaped diamond.
Thick fingers will look best with pear, round, or princess cut stones.
• You should go to your local jewelers for comparing the various diamond shapes.
You should check out the various diamonds with a variety of carat weight and range of quality.
He or she can compare how the shape actually affects the diamond's visual size.
The diamond should look visually appealing in an engagement ring setting.
Only a jeweler can help you find the perfect shape for each and every type of engagement rings.
